From: Tvrtko Ursulin <[email protected]>

DRM_DEBUG_WARN_ON should only be used when we are certain CI is guaranteed
to exercise a certain code path, so in case of values coming from MMIO
reads we cannot be sure CI will have all the possible SKUs and parts.

Use drm_warn instead and move logging to init phase while at it.

Changing to drm_warn looks good, although moving the location changes
the intent a bit; I think originally the idea was to warn if we were
trying to do a steering lookup for a type that we never initialized
(e.g., an LNCF lookup for a !HAS_MSLICES platform where we never even
read the register in the first place).  But I don't think we've ever
made a mistake that would cause us to trip the warning, so it probably
isn't terribly important to keep it there.

Ah I see.. there we could put something like:

        case MSLICE:
                GEM_WARN_ON(!HAS_MSLICES(...));


Yeah, that would work for MSLICE and LNCF.  Although L3BANK is a bit
stranger since we have multiple platforms that obtain the L3 bank mask
in completely different ways (Xe_HP reads it from XEHP_FUSE4, whereas
gen11/gen12 reads it from GEN10_MIRROR_FUSE3).  We want to make sure
there that no matter which branch of init we take, we didn't forget to
initialize l3bank_mask somehow.

The two init paths are not something present in drm-tip at this point, right? At least I couldn't find it. In which case it could be handled later by moving the drm_warn to tail of intel_gt_init_mmio, give or take.

Anyway, I've sent v2 out with your r-b and GEM_WARN_ON for mslice/lncf. I won't merge it though until you definitely are okay with it so please have a look and confirm.
